Sterling84 Posted February 5, 2013 Share Posted February 5, 2013 i HATE that they changed the spots. the jaguar spots are supposed to be bulls-eye like... semi circles with a small spot in the middle. the old one sorta had that, the new one eliminates it completly. thats the main aethetic difference between a jaguar and, say a cheetah.Actually, those are called Rosettes. And in as much as they are the defining pattern feature that separates Jaguars and Leopards from Cheetahs, the rosettes turn into spots as the fur approaches the feet and/or the head (turn to stripes at the tail). So in that sense, they didn't flub it. The Official Cheese-Filled Snack of NASCAR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
